Create a funding session

How it works

Ask for a funding session for an amount; we return a checkout_url. There are two kinds, picked with link_type:
  • hosted (default): an Agentcard-hosted payment page. Render it anywhere — an “Add funds” button, a QR code, a chat message — and the user opens it and pays with Apple Pay, Google Pay, or card. Safe to relay: the underlying payment order is created only when the user opens the page. Creating a hosted session is free; an unopened link costs nothing.
  • embedded: an in-app payment link, minted immediately. Load checkout_url in a WKWebView (iOS) or Android WebView and the user pays without leaving your app.
When the payment completes, the funds land in the user’s wallet. Poll GET /api/v2/wallet/fund/{session_id} to know when — that endpoint is the source of truth for money; treat any client-side signal as advisory.

Fees: send the exact amount

Agentcard covers the payment provider’s fee. Send amount_cents for exactly what the user should receive — the wallet is credited the full amount. Do not gross up the charge to compensate for fees; that just over-charges your user.
  • fee_cents on the create and status responses is the provider’s fee (which Agentcard absorbs) when known, or null while it isn’t yet — null means “unknown”, never “free”.
  • fees_covered tells you whether the fee is on us: true (it is — the user receives the full amount_cents), false (an anomalous fee we won’t absorb — the wallet receives the net amount), or null (fee not known yet). false is rare; treat it as net delivery rather than failing the flow.

Requirements

  • The user must be identity-verified. Funding reuses the user’s completed identity verification — there is no separate verification step inside checkout. If the user isn’t verified, create-session returns 422 kyc_required; run identity verification first, then retry. Other verification-related 422s:
    • funding_profile_required — a one-time funding profile is missing (collect it, then retry).
    • kyc_transfer_required — the user’s existing verification needs a one-time carry-over before funding (a single extra step, no re-verification).
    • unsupported — the user’s verification can’t be used for funding. The body’s reason names the wall. restricted_country (or a *_region_unsupported value) means the user’s country of residence isn’t served for funding: nothing about their verification is missing, so don’t send them back through identity verification. incomplete_address, no_identity_document, no_nationality, no_phone, and no_full_ssn (US residents) clear once that detail is on the user’s verification.
  • Amount bounds come from the API. If the amount is out of range you get 422 amount_out_of_range with min_amount_cents and max_amount_cents in the response — read those rather than hardcoding limits.
  • Link lifetime. Every session has a 30-minute window (expires_at), but a link is consumed by use, not just by time. A hosted link is single-use: the moment the user opens the page and starts the payment sheet, that link is spent, even if they close it without paying. An embedded link must be rendered immediately (its underlying payment token lives about 5 minutes).
  • Abandoned sessions need no cleanup. There is no cancel endpoint because none is needed: an unpaid session never charges, holds no funds, and flips to expired on its own. To retry, create a new session at any time; sessions are independent of each other, and creating hosted sessions is free and not throttled. See session status for the poll-side rule.

Embedded: in-app checkout

Create the session with link_type: "embedded", hand checkout_url to your app, and load it in a WebView:
  • Apple Pay renders inside a WKWebView on iOS 16+ (Apple Pay on the Web is supported in WKWebView, but not in SFSafariViewController — use a WKWebView). On older iOS the user pays with Google Pay or card. No domain verification is required on your side; the checkout runs on our Apple-registered domain and pops the native Apple Pay sheet in-app.
  • Google Pay works in a modern Android WebView; card is always available as a fallback.
  • Completion: the page navigates to /fund/success when the payment completes — observe that navigation to close your WebView — and the status endpoint is the authoritative confirmation.
  • Wallet-only sheet: append &only=apple_pay (or &only=google_pay) to the checkout_url fragment to present just that wallet button with no card form.

Mint on demand, not per render

Every embedded session creates a real payment order the moment you call the endpoint. Mint one only when the user has actually initiated payment (tapped “Add funds”), render it immediately, and create a fresh session for the next attempt if the link lapses. Don’t mint on page render or in retry loops — the API refuses excess pending sessions for the same user with too_many_pending_sessions.
  • Never relay an embedded link through chat or email; link unfurlers can consume it and leave the user a dead page. Server → WebView, immediately, is the only safe path.
  • The embedded checkout_url appears only on the create response; the status endpoint never re-serves it. If it lapsed, create a new session.
  • Test with sandbox-mode credentials — sandbox clients create TEST orders (never charged), so you can exercise the full WebView flow end to end before switching to live keys.
  • On a physical device, cards must be in the platform wallet; simulators cannot show the Apple Pay sheet.

A platform access token. Get one on the Create an access token endpoint by exchanging your client_id + client_secret, then send it as Authorization: Bearer <token>. Tokens live one hour.

hosted returns an Agentcard-hosted payment page, safe to relay anywhere (chat, email, QR); the underlying payment order is created only when the user opens it, so unopened hosted sessions cost nothing. embedded creates a REAL payment order immediately for rendering inside your own app; mint it only when the user initiates payment, render it immediately, and never relay it through chat (link unfurlers consume it). Embedded responses carry checkout_style (crossmint_sdk | cb_onramp | web) — branch your rendering on it: crossmint_sdk boots Crossmint's native mobile SDK from the response's crossmint object (native Apple Pay / Google Pay sheet in-app), cb_onramp loads checkout_url in a WKWebView with the cbOnramp message handler (Apple Pay only — google_pay on that rail is rejected with payment_method_not_supported; the link lives about 5 minutes and counts toward the user's per-user payment limits even if never paid), web opens checkout_url in a browser context. The payment link to show the user. hosted: an Agentcard-hosted page, present while the link can still be opened. embedded: the raw provider Apple Pay link, present ONLY on the create response; the poll endpoint never re-serves it, so load it in an in-app webview immediately, never relay it, and create a new session if it lapses.

On the create response: hosted links stay openable for 30 minutes; embedded links are single-use and expire about 5 minutes after creation (create a new session instead of retrying a lapsed link). On the poll endpoint, expires_at always reflects the session's 30-minute fundability window, not the embedded link's shorter life.

The payment provider's fee in USD cents, which Agentcard covers (see fees_covered) — the user's wallet is credited the full amount_cents, so do NOT gross up the charge. Null while the fee isn't known yet (e.g. a hosted link whose payment order hasn't been minted) — null means unknown, never free. Always present on both the create response and the poll endpoint.

fees_covered
boolean | null

Whether Agentcard absorbs the provider fee for this session. true: the wallet receives the full amount_cents — send the exact amount the user should receive and do not gross up. false (rare): the fee was anomalous and the wallet receives the net amount. null: the fee isn't known yet. After completion this reflects the actual outcome.

Embedded create responses only — which rendering contract applies. 'crossmint_sdk': initialize Crossmint's native mobile checkout SDK with the crossmint object (native Apple Pay / Google Pay sheet in-app; checkout_url stays a web fallback). 'cb_onramp': load checkout_url in a WKWebView with a script message handler named cbOnramp (native Apple Pay button page with lifecycle events). 'web': open checkout_url in a browser context; the page navigates to /fund/success on completion. Treat unrecognized values as 'web'.

Embedded create responses on the crossmint_sdk style only — the PREFERRED integration. A fully-built, provider-opaque wallet-button page: load it as-is in an in-app webview (Agentcard's iOS tooling renders it as a native-looking Apple Pay button pill). Built entirely server-side, so the payment rail behind it can change without any partner-side work. Same one-time, single-order lifetime as the credentials it embeds.

Boot credentials for Crossmint's native checkout SDK (Swift / Kotlin / React Native) — an alternative to embed_url for apps that prefer the vendor SDK. client_secret is scoped to this single order and is returned exactly once — hand it to the paying user's device, never store or relay it; create a new session if it is lost.
